PTAC to Hold 'Advance Market Research' Seminar at Jacquart Fabric Products

IRONWOOD, MI - Tuesday, November 24, 2009 - On December 9th, the Procurement Technical Assistance Center (PTAC) will be hosting an “Advance Market Research” seminar at Jacquart Fabric Products, 1238 Wall Street, Ironwood, Michigan 49938.

Market research is a continuous process designed to gather data on government agencies and prime contractors. It assesses your needs so you can make good decisions about promoting your products and services to them.

Registration for the “Advance Market Research” seminar will be 8:30-9:00 AM, with the seminar being held from 9:00 AM – noon. During this seminar you will learn where to find government buying forecasts and purchasing history; which agencies and departments purchase your goods and/or services; who are your competitors.

The presenter for this class will be Todd Olson, PTAC Program Director with the Northwest Michigan Council of Governments. The PTAC is a non-profit organization that provides no fee assistance to companies who are interested in doing business with state and federal government agencies. PTAC Procurement Counselors help businesses to understand government contracting and selling to the government.
